Output d589503b531de7667f96e6f8f71619caddf266b4330eb6af08efeef5bf7f0881:9

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f523f8f422fb1a165092d24b61837edfb1d02c1 OP_EQUAL
address
3K8dWtokKeWFvL9YRibLNAgbTcggz8Gj6m
transaction
d589503b531de7667f96e6f8f71619caddf266b4330eb6af08efeef5bf7f0881
confirmations
331505
spent
true